20090094867Compact rescue signal device - The Compact Rescue Signal Device is designed to help lost or stranded hikers. This device is approximately the size of a small flashlight and comes in a variety of colors. When activating the lever a 30 Mylar balloon imprinted with the letter SOS is filled by a lighter than air gas. From this stage the balloon can be deployed and become more visible on the attached 75 foot tether to aid in the quicker recovery of lost or stranded hikers and helping to lower cost of state and federal rescue operations. Also included is a reflective disk on the outer cap of this device to assist when needed. The design of operation is easily operated by children and adults and light enough to carry in a pant pocket or small daypack.04-16-2009
20090133299Message display balloon - A dynamic messaging system comprises a balloon, a lighting array disposed within the balloon and further comprising a plurality of light-emitting diodes, a power source connected to the lighting array, and a means for rotating the lighting array within the balloon. In a first preferred embodiment, the lighting arrays includes a plurality of light-emitting diodes that are capable of generating monochrome visible light, thereby providing simple graphics and alphanumeric messages. In a second preferred embodiment, the lighting array includes a plurality of light-emitting diodes are capable of generating colored visible light, thereby providing complex graphics and messages. In a third embodiment, the lighting array includes a plurality of ultraviolet laser diodes that generate graphics and messages on an inner, flourescent-coated surface of the balloon.05-28-2009

20100115808INFLATABLE FLAG DISPLAY - An inflatable flag display includes a shaft having a hollow core and a sealed upper end. An aperture is located in the upper portion of the shaft and penetrates from an outer surface to the hollow core. A supporting base is connected to the shaft. A gas input connection is affixed to the shaft or the base and is in fluid communication with the core. An inflatable flag member is affixed to the shaft, formed of flexible material and has at least one inflatable chamber. The chamber is in fluid communication with the aperture and has an exhaust vent. A compressed gas source is in fluid communication with the gas input connection. A compressed gas modulator controls pressure or duration of gas flow, causing the flag to undulate. A variant includes means for rotating the shaft as the flag is inflated. Another variant includes an inflatable column replacing the shaft.05-13-2010

20100287801LOCALIZED SEALANT APPLICATION IN AEROSTATS - Formation of an aerostat through the application of a pressure sensitive adhesive onto one or more barrier films at the desired point of bonding between the films. The adhesive is applied about the periphery prior to the point of bonding the two barrier films together. The method of the present invention results in aerostats with a bond line at the edge of the desired shape. The reduced weight, in comparison to conventional practices employing a heat sealing layer, enables intricate designs and smaller volume aerostats.11-18-2010

20100319226Tethered Airborne Advertising system - A tethered airborne advertising system comprises a lifting element and a separate display structure. The lifting element includes, for example, one or more kites or lighter-than-air balloons. The display structure is lifted primarily by the lifting element, exhibits one or more advertising images and may have one or more attention-getting devices affixed to it. In certain embodiments, operation of these advertising images and attention-getting devices can be controlled remotely by way of a signal transmitter and signal receiver. Particular embodiments place the advertising images onto the display structure by way of a ground-based or onboard projector subsystem. The mounted attention-getting devises may include those capable of generating smoke, sound, music, dynamic images, or releasing environmentally friendly confetti or advertising fliers.12-23-2010

20110271567Aerial Advertising Device - An aerial advertising device for providing predictable and consistent oscillations to a banner towed behind an aircraft. The aerial advertising device may be disposed at the bottom of the leading edge of a banner. The device may generally comprise a weight box disposed above a wind box. The device may be rotatable about the leading edge or extension, wherein the range of motion of such rotation may be limited by a restriction arm preventing further motion of the device relative to the leading edge. Such rotation may allow the inside walls of the wind box to transfer the applied wind force to the rotation of the device and thereby the rotation of the leading edge of the banner. The weight box may further comprise a horizontal translation arm upon which a slidable weight may slide as the translation arm is moved into greater angular positions relative to horizontal.11-10-2011
